Surprised by all the mixed/negative reviews here, because I LOVED this. Not much in the way of plot, but the beauty is in the rich characterizations & Renault is just so, so good at capturing the gravity of even the smallest gestures, interactions, & silences between people—& how they can slowly ripple out with life-changing repercussions.
